Communications Manager - African Population and Health Research Center (APHRC) Kenya Jobs

The African Population and Health Research Center (APHRC) is an international non-profit, non-governmental organization that carries out policy relevant research on population, health, education and development issues facing sub-Saharan Africa.

The Center seeks to recruit a
 Communications Manager.

Duties
  • Coordinate the development, production and circulation of Institutional publications
  • Edit and coordinate the production of Working Papers and Research Reports
  • Plan and implement communication activities at international, regional and national levels.
  • Work with, and through, national, regional and international networks to facilitate engagement with APHRC’s research evidence
  • Support project-specific dissemination activities
  • Strengthen APHRC’s work through media networks and associations

  • Identify relevant TV/Radio programs and pitch for TV interviews with APHRC researchers
  • Provide support in the organization of community events
  • Support or initiate activities that promote awareness of APHRC’s work among various publics
  • Provide advise on website content and design
  • Initiate and / or support other e-dissemination activities
  • Identify & make available or explore availability of e-resources relevant to APHRC research work
  • Explore fundraising opportunities for Communication activities and participate in development of proposals
Skills and Qualifications
  • MA or MSc in mass communications, information sciences (publishing major), or public relations
  • At least three years of hands-on experience in undertaking similar work
  • Excellent writing skills and ability to translate complex scientific facts into simple messages for general audiences.
  • Computer literacy with proficiency in MS Office products, and Desk-Top Publishing software
